Levi Strauss Is Even More Fully Priced Than Before, Too Much Risk Ahead
LEVI
Published: October 10, 2025 by: Seeking Alpha
Sentiment: Positive

Levi Strauss & Co. delivered strong Q3 results, driven by international growth and resilience in the US despite tariff pressures. International markets, especially Latin America and Asia, powered revenue gains, while US direct-to-consumer sales and price increases supported margins. LEVI's gross margins improved, but SG&A deleveraging and cyclical high margins raise concerns about sustainability if fashion trends or demand weaken.

Levi's shares slide as tariff concerns overshadow Q3 earnings beat
LEVI
Published: October 10, 2025 by: Proactive Investors
Sentiment: Negative

Levi Strauss & Co (NYSE:LEVI) shares pulled back premarket as concerns about the impact of the costs of tariffs on the jeans-maker overshadowed better-than-expected third quarter earnings. For Q3, revenue of $1.54 billion topped estimates of $1.5 billion, up 7% from the year-ago quarter.

About Levi Strauss & Co. (LEVI)

  • IPO Date 2019-03-21
  • Website https://www.levistrauss.com
  • Industry Apparel - Manufacturers
  • CEO Michelle D. Gass
  • Employees 18700

Levi Strauss & Co. operates as an apparel company. The company designs, markets, and sells jeans, casual and dress pants, activewear, tops, shorts, skirts, dresses, jackets, footwear, and related accessories for men, women, and children in the Americas, Europe, and Asia. It also sells its products under the Levi's, Dockers, Signature by Levi Strauss & Co., and Denizen brands. In addition, the company licenses Levi's and Dockers trademarks for various product categories, including footwear, belts, wallets and bags, outerwear, sweaters, dress shirts, kids wear, sleepwear, and hosiery. Further, it sells its products through third-party retailers, such as department stores, specialty retailers, third-party e-commerce sites, and franchisees who operate brand-dedicated stores; and directly to consumers through various formats, including company-operated mainline and outlet stores, company-operated e-commerce sites, and select shop-in-shops located in department stores, and other third-party retail locations. The company also operates approximately 3,100 brand-dedicated stores and shop-in-shops. The company was founded in 1853 and is headquartered in San Francisco, California.
